At Apple, we push the boundaries of what's possible - and that starts with the engineers who test it. As a System Test Engineer on our Wireless Technologies team, you'll play a pivotal role in ensuring Apple devices deliver seamless, world-class 5G and 6G connectivity across every network, every carrier, and every corner of the globe. If you thrive at the intersection of deep protocol knowledge and cutting-edge innovation, this is where your expertise will shape products used by hundreds of millions of people.
Description
In this role, you will be at the forefront of validating next-generation wireless connectivity on Apple products through rigorous interoperability testing across 5G and emerging 6G standards.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ams spanning silicon, software, and RF engineering to design and execute system-level test strategies that span physical layer performance to end-to-end protocol behavior. Working with global carrier partners and industry standards, you'll leverage AI/ML-driven tooling and scalable automation frameworks to uncover issues early and drive quality to the highest bar - all in pursuit of delivering the best possible wireless experience to Apple customers worldwide.
","responsibilities":"Design, develop, and execute system-level interoperability test plans for 5G NR (Sub-6 and FR2/mmWave) and emerging 6G technologies across commercial and lab network environments
Analyze 3GPP protocol stacks and physical layer behavior to identify failure modes and drive root cause analysis on complex wireless issues
Build and maintain automated test frameworks and AI/ML-assisted diagnostic tools to accelerate test coverage and reduce manual effort
Partner with carrier and chipset partners to define interoperability test scenarios and reproduce field-reported issues in a controlled lab setting
Collaborate with hardware, software, and RF teams to validate new device features against evolving 3GPP specifications
Triage, document, and track defects with clear technical detail, working closely with engineering teams to drive issues to resolution
Contribute to the development of internal test infrastructure, signal analysis pipelines, and reporting dashboards
Stay current with 3GPP Release roadmaps and proactively identify testing gaps as standards evolve
Preferred Qualifications
Experience with 6G research concepts, IMT-2030 frameworks, or pre-standard wireless technologies
Hands-on experience with carrier interoperability testing and field trial environments
Knowledge of 5G core network architecture (5GC), network slicing, and SA/NSA deployment modes
Experience with iOS or embedded platform debugging and log analysis tools
Background in RF performance testing including beam management, MIMO, and FR2 mmWave characterization
Familiarity with test management and CI/CD pipelines for continuous test integration
Strong cross-functional communication skills with the ability to present technical findings to diverse audiences
Minimum Qualifications
Master's degree (MS) in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Telecommunications, or a related field
3+ years of hands-on experience in wireless system testing, interoperability testing, or protocol validation
Deep knowledge of 3GPP standards including 5G NR physical layer (FR1 and FR2/mmWave), RRC, NAS, and related protocols
Proficiency in scripting and automation (Python, shell, or similar) for test development and result analysis
Experience with AI/ML tools for test data analysis, anomaly detection, or tool development
Familiarity with lab test equipment such as network emulators, protocol analyzers, and signal analyzers

How do I get a wireless engineer job in San Diego?
Focus your search on San Diego's defense contractors, telecom infrastructure firms, and fabless semiconductor companies, which drive the bulk of local hiring. Roles concentrate in Sorrento Valley, Kearny Mesa, and the Rancho Bernardo corridor. Candidates with RF design, antenna systems, or 5G protocol experience stand out here, and a DoD security clearance significantly expands your options given how many local employers work on government programs.

Are there remote wireless engineer jobs in San Diego?
Yes, but selectively, since much wireless engineering involves hands-on lab work, antenna testing, or on-site hardware integration that requires physical presence. About 33% of wireless engineer openings tied to San Diego are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, with those options appearing most often in systems architecture, standards work, and RF simulation roles rather than test or integration positions.
How can I get a wireless engineer job in San Diego with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path in San Diego is targeting defense subcontractors and mid-size telecom equipment firms in Kearny Mesa and Sorrento Valley, which regularly hire junior RF or systems engineers. Entry-level roles in antenna test support, signal processing, or wireless protocol validation are common stepping stones. A BSEE with coursework in electromagnetics or wireless communications, combined with lab project experience, gives you a competitive profile with local employers.
